Joel’s chance to stake keeper claim
Date published: 28 July 2015
Joel Coleman is set to start in goal tonight - and boss Darren Kelly sees a straight fight for a place between the teenager and equally-matched recent signing from Swansea, David Cornell.
“Both goalkeepers have done well and have been excellent in training,” Kelly said. “We are still identifying who will be the number one come Walsall. It would have been easy to bring in a young goalkeeper from a Premier League club, someone happy to get experience sitting on our bench.
“I didn’t want to do that and we are happy to see Joel and David go head to head.”
